Research and Data function records retention schedule

Research and Data function records retention schedule
Type of record Retention period Trigger Reason and/or relevant legislation Action at end of retention period
Academic research papers 10 years End of use Business need Review
Conference papers 6 years Date of conference Business need Review
Conference planner, publication timetables and stakeholder management 3 years End of use Business need Destroy
Consumer videos 3 years Date of video Business need Destroy
Data sets, details of working groups, methodology papers, questionnaires 6 years End of use Business need Review
Qualitative data sets 6 years Report finalised Business need Review
Research and statistics (including written research and end product reports) 20 years End of use Public Records Act 1958 Transfer to National Archives
Regular feed of Operator Core Data (ROCD) received from operators 10 years Date received Business need Destroy
Statistics - including Freedom Of Information (FOI) requests, Lottery statistics and Industry statistics 15 years Date published Public Records Act 1958; National Archives retention guidance Transfer to National Archives
